Grade K Math Parent Workshop
Counting and Beyond
Thursday, November 3rd 8:45-9:45 am Room 418
Children come to school with many ideas about numbers. In kindergarten, we build on these ideas as we explore counting strategies and develop an understanding of relationships between numbers. At this workshop, we will explore early number concepts that are essential to building a strong foundation for addition and subtraction. Try some hands-on activities and take games home to play with your child!Led by Rachel Michael (rmichael@bsi686.org)
Grade 2 Math Parent Workshop
Addition and Subtraction Strategies: Thinking Flexibly
Wednesday, November 2nd 8:45-9:45 am-Room 418
In 2nd grade, we expect our students to have multiple strategies for addition and subtraction. So what are those strategies? In this workshop, we will explore the various addition and subtraction strategies that children use and their relationship to place value. Come learn about how the number line is a useful tool for addition/subtraction. We will also take a look at the Common Core expectations for addition and subtraction and discuss why flexible strategy use is so important!
